Skocz do zawartości
Samael

Serwer dla aplikacji mailingowej

Polecane posty

Witam,

słowem wstępu - firma w której pracuję kończy prace nad aplikacją do rozsyłania mailingu przez osoby trzecie.

Klient po rejestracji otrzymuje własny adres email, następie przesyła przez formularz swoją bazę maili, opłaca sobie pakiet, dodaje szablon i będzie sobie rozsyłać maile w najlepsze - bez ingerencji kogokolwiek innego, z podglądem na żywo itd.

Po zakończeniu rozsyłania automatycznie baza maili zostaje usunięta z systemu.

Zabezpieczenia stały się priorytetem dla mojego szefostwa i przez to gwarantuję, że maile nie będą do "podebrania" przez kogokolwiek - nawet administratora serwisu.

 

 

Moje pytanie brzmi - Jaki serwer na początek powinniśmy wybrać?

Realnie rzecz biorąc liczymy, że w pierwszym roku średnio miesięcznie z naszej aplikacji nadane zostanie od 5.000.000 do 25.000.000 maili (do 20 mali/sek.).

 

Inne preferowane parametry to:

  • Pojemność konta minimum 50GB;
  • Brak limitu wielkości bazy danych (limit = pojemność całkowita konta);
  • Obsługa Crone jobs;
  • Dodatkowo: możliwość dodawania kont pocztowych z poziomu aplikacji internetowej (po napisaniu odpowiedniego kodu);

Budżet owszem jest ograniczony i liczymy na przyzwoitą cenę, ale nie podam go, aby nim się nie sugerować.

Ważne aby serwer podołał funkcjonalności aplikacji i zakładanym obciążeniom.

 

Przewidywany termin podpisania umowy to 21 września br.

 

 

Z góry dziękuję za uzyskane odpowiedzi.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Pytanie winno brzmieć ile minimalnie serwerów potrzebujesz i jak bardzo będzie ustawiane rotowanie wychodzących adresów IP by dostarczalność była akceptowalna.

 

 

Raczej potrzebujesz kilka(naście) vpsów w różnych firmach i spięcie ich by było zróżnicowanie IP i wysyłka nie powodowała wpadnięcia w limity serwerów odbiorców

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Jestem prostym programistom, moim zadaniem było - a raczej nadal jest - stworzenie przyjemnego w obsłudze, wydajnego narzędzia do rozsyłania biuletynów mailingowych.

Jeśli mówisz, że rozwiązaniem najlepszym byłoby dywersyfikacja jednostek rozsyłających.

Zatem... jedna aplikacja rozsyłająca zlokalizowana na wielu serwerach oraz dodatkowa aplikacja na serwerze z domeną aplikacji która zarządzałaby użytkownikami i kampaniami oraz gromadziłaby dane mailingowe.

 

To zmienia zasadniczo postać aplikacji.

A czy możliwe jest - pytam jako zielony w tym temacie - podpięcie wielu domen i adresów ip (1 domena = 1 IP) pod jeden serwer tak aby pozostać przy obecnej formie aplikacji?

I ile tak naprawdę potrzebuję tych IP'ków żeby to dobrze obsługiwało i nie zbanowano aplikacji jako spamerska?

Udostępnij ten post


Link to postu
Udostępnij na innych stronach
Gość l3szcz

Jest to możliwe, ale zauważ, że jeżeli ktoś Ci zgłosi klasę adresową do RBL, to wiadomości będą trafiać do folderu SPAM i niestety - nie przyda się to na nic. Przede wszystkim przy rozłożeniu baz e-mailowych (1000 maili per klient x 100 klientów), będą potrzebne co najmniej 3 VPSy w różnych firmach. Aplikacja główna może być na jednym serwerze - Ty tylko konfigurujesz protokoły SMTP dla różnych serwerów. Do tego umowa z GIODO i odpowiednie zabezpieczenie haseł klientów, aby nikt nie mógł pobrać listy e-maili.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Do tego umowa z GIODO i odpowiednie zabezpieczenie haseł klientów, aby nikt nie mógł pobrać listy e-maili.

Umowa z GIODO mimo, że sami nie posiadamy własnej bazy emailowej?

Z naszej strony jest zapewnienie narzędzia nie maili.

 

Zabezpieczenie dla klientów jest - mówią kolokwialnie - MEGA.

Ostatni raz tak mocne zabezpieczenia tworzyłem dla serwisu uzupełniającego dla pewnego banku (nie, nie system bankowy ale i tak wymagali takich samych środków zabezpieczających).

 

Ale wracając do meritum sprawy - ktoś może zaproponować jakieś konkretne oferty?

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Zważywszy na powyższe informacje (wiele VPS'ów) - żałosny.

Przedział od 50 do 250 złotych netto miesięcznie.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Rozumiem, że żartujesz:

Moje pytanie brzmi - Jaki serwer na początek powinniśmy wybrać?

Realnie rzecz biorąc liczymy, że w pierwszym roku średnio miesięcznie z naszej aplikacji nadane zostanie od 5.000.000 do 25.000.000 maili (do 20 mali/sek.).

 

 

Przy takiej ilości maili tylko serwer dedykowany.

 

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Weź sobie zamów 10 vpsów w różnych firmach - takie najtańsze bez administracji. Zleć komuś jednorazową konfiguracje tego i będzie śmigać.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Rozumiem, że żartujesz:

 

 

Przy takiej ilości maili tylko serwer dedykowany.

 

W żadnym wypadku nie potrzebujesz serwera dedykowanego, tylko kilku - kilkunastu serwerów VPS, w których poprawnie skonfigurujesz SPF, DKIM, revDNS.

Oprócz tego zgłosisz się do dużych operatorów po status mass-sendera, ale może być z tym ciężko w Twoim przypadku.

 

Wychodzi na to, że chcesz rozsyłać conajmniej 160 tys maili dziennie, bezpiecznie można przyjąć, że z jednego serwera/adresu-ip możesz wysłać tak 15-20 tys maili, aby dostarczalność była sensowna. Czyli na początek 8 serwerów VPS, mogą być jak najbardziej bardzo skromne. Najlepiej rozrzucone po różnych operatorach. Oczywiście możesz opracować sobie jakąś technike rotacji adresów IP przy wysyłce z jednego serwera i wziąć mocniejszego VM/CT.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ach
W żadnym wypadku nie potrzebujesz serwera dedykowanego, tylko kilku - kilkunastu serwerów VPS, w których poprawnie skonfigurujesz SPF, DKIM, revDNS.

 

Oczywiście, że można to rozłożyć na kilkanaście VPS, autor myślał jednak o jednym serwerze

Tylko koszty konfiguracji takich kilkunastu serwerów ...

 

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Ale on nie będzie generował dużego obciążenia przez MTA, nawet przy takim wolumenie. Potrzebuje tylko dużo adresów IP i poprawnej konfiguracji.

Co do rozbicia na większą ilość serwerów, to pewnie kosztowałoby masę, gdyby zlecić to cieniasowi, który nie ogarnia automatyzacji procesów wdrożeniowych. Może masa to przesada, bo taka konfiguracja to góra 30 minut roboty, więc przy moich założeniach i 8 VPSach będą to koszta 4 godzin pracy administratora * 100-150zł netto za godzinę...
W każdym razie
Od czego np. playbooki ansible? Jeżeli klient zakłada dokładanie kolejnych serwerów to dobry administrator będzie trochę myślał za niego i wymyśli rozwiązanie, które ułatwi mu to i utnie koszta. No chyba, że nie potrafi...

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

No nie będzie, ale popatrz na jego budżet, max 250 złotych netto.

Konfiguracja samych kilkunastu maszyn wyjdzie więcej, chociaż z drugiej strony jest to jednorazowy większy wydatek.

Udostępnij ten post


Link to postu
Udostępnij na innych stronach

Bądź aktywny! Zaloguj się lub utwórz konto

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to

Zarejestruj nowe konto, to proste!

Zarejestruj nowe konto

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się


×